COACHING CONFLICT Policy
COACHing conflict Policy
The Core Rule: When two students from our program play each other in a tournament (singles or doubles), I will remain completely neutral and will not coach either player.
How It Works:
Pre-Match: I will offer equal encouragement to both sides and step away. You are responsible for your own warm-up.
During the Match: You must rely on your own problem-solving, AND ARE WELCOME TO ASK OTHERS TO COACH IN Between GAMES.
Post-Match: compete fiercely, but always shake hands at the END OF THE MATCH when it is over.
Match Review: I am happy to sit down with you after the tournament to objectively review the match and discuss areas for improvement.
For Parents & Spectators: Please keep cheering positive and respectful. Applaud good plays from both sides of the net to support the whole program.
